+- port_vlan_filtering: bridge layer function invoked when the bridge gets
+  configured for turning on or off VLAN filtering. If nothing specific needs to
+  be done at the hardware level, this callback does not need to be implemented.
+  When VLAN filtering is turned on, the hardware must be programmed with
+  rejecting 802.1Q frames which have VLAN IDs outside of the programmed allowed
+  VLAN ID map/rules.  If there is no PVID programmed into the switch port,
+  untagged frames must be rejected as well. When turned off the switch must
+  accept any 802.1Q frames irrespective of their VLAN ID, and untagged frames 
are
+  allowed.
